SQL Server 2008允许用户自己定义函数。关于内联表值函数,有下列说法: Ⅰ.在内联表值函数中,没有相关联的返回变量 Ⅱ.内联表值函数通过INSERT语句填充函数返回的表值 Ⅲ.内联表值函数的作用类似于带参数的视图

admin2020-11-05  34

问题 SQL Server 2008允许用户自己定义函数。关于内联表值函数,有下列说法:
    Ⅰ.在内联表值函数中,没有相关联的返回变量
    Ⅱ.内联表值函数通过INSERT语句填充函数返回的表值
    Ⅲ.内联表值函数的作用类似于带参数的视图
    Ⅳ.调用内联表值函数时,只能将内联表值函数放置在FROM子句中
    上述说法中正确的是(    )。

选项 A、仅Ⅱ
B、仅Ⅱ和Ⅲ
C、仅Ⅰ、Ⅱ和Ⅳ
D、仅Ⅰ、Ⅲ和Ⅳ

答案D

解析 内联表值函数的返回值是一个表,该表的内容是一个查询语句的结果;内联表值函数的使用与视图非常相似,需要放在查询语句的FROM子句中,作用很像是带参数的视图;内联表值函数通过SELECT、语句填充函数返回的表值。
转载请注明原文地址:https://jikaoti.com/ti/DL37FFFM
0

最新回复(0)